"Formerly historic warehouses and a jam factory, this hotel is on the waterfront, backed by Mount Wellington."
"Arguably one of Australia's best hotels, right on the Hobart waterfront, this row of historic warehouses and a former jam factory have been transformed into a sensational, art-theme hotel." Full review
"A stunning conversion of the old jam factory on the waterfront, with stylish room decor featuring contemporary art. Some of the suites have harbour views and spas."
"Winner of the Australian Hotel Association Best Overall Hotel in 2005, this is a stylish, first-class hotel with a strong focus on Tasmanian art and design."
"The Henry Jones Art Hotel is the top pick for fashion-conscious travelers in search of an eclectic address in a convenient and lively location." Full review

"The Henry Jones Art Hotel is a 56-room upscale property housed in a renovated jam factory dating back to 1804." Full review
"The walls of this five-star hotel are hung with more than 400 works, in changing exhibitions...Guest rooms are also works of art in themselves, reflecting Australia’s early trade with China and India" Full review

"You won't find a better value than the rooms above this historic sandstone pub overlooking the waterfront." Full review
"This deceptively spacious hotel is housed within a pretty sandstone building above a popular (and often boisterous) pub, just moments from Salamanca Place and Battery Point."
"Compact, modestly stylish pub rooms in a former harbour warehouse, all en suite and the best with old stone walls."
